is Service Worked - Android android.app

Android examples for android.app:ActivityManager

Description

is Service Worked

Demo Code

import android.app.ActivityManager;
import android.content.Context;
import android.content.pm.PackageInfo;
import java.util.ArrayList;
import java.util.List;

public class Main{

    public static boolean isServiceWorked(Context context,
            String serviceName) {
        ActivityManager myManager = (ActivityManager) context
                .getSystemService(Context.ACTIVITY_SERVICE);
        ArrayList<ActivityManager.RunningServiceInfo> runningService = (ArrayList<ActivityManager.RunningServiceInfo>) myManager
                .getRunningServices(30);
        for (int i = 0; i < runningService.size(); i++) {
            if (runningService.get(i).service.getClassName().toString()
                    .equals(serviceName)) {
                return true;
            }/*from   w  ww.  ja  v  a 2s.  c  o  m*/
        }
        return false;
    }

}

Related Tutorials